The Quietbell deduplicator exposes a single ingest endpoint that fingerprints incoming alerts and suppresses repeats within a configurable window. All requests must be authenticated; unauthenticated calls are rejected with 401 and logged to the Tinderbox audit stream. Keys are scoped per sending service and cannot read suppression state, only write alerts. Reviewers should note that key rotation is enforced every 60 days. The current ingest key for the staging tier appears below.

service key, fawip-bajef: kto11_Qt5wZK9vdNC

Minutes — Management Meeting, Dornick Hall

Present: J. Calver, L. Renstow, sales leads.

Large-deal discount policy reviewed. New rule: deals above the Varnley band capped at 25% discount; anything higher requires J. Calver's approval plus a margin sheet. Two recent breaches at Okkra Industries noted; no further exceptions. Pipeline impact estimated as minor. Policy effective immediately; sales leads to brief teams by Friday. The confidential plan this supports is recorded below.

internal memo for hafog-hadug: The pricing group signed off on a budget of $16.1 million for Project Gorir. The renewal with Oliionax Systems closes at $14.1 million a year, 46 percent above the last contract.

Quarterly Planning Note — Branch Managers

This quarter we are adjusting pricing across the Merrowfield Home line. List prices rise 4% on the Cedar and Slate tiers; the Birch tier holds steady to protect entry-level volume. Competitive moves by Hallowen Goods prompted the review. Please do not apply discounts beyond the published matrix without regional approval. Margin targets remain unchanged. Strategic context for these changes appears below.

confidential, yagep-kagef: Rusvanox Holdings is in early talks to buy Julwynix Systems for about $454.5 million. The Fenael launch date is April 23, and nothing goes to the press before then. Legal wants the Druwynix Works term sheet redrafted before January 8.

**Ticket: Fan-out workers silently dropping alerts**

Stormcall's weather-alert fan-out on staging has been eating alerts since Tuesday. Turns out the env on the worker pods is missing half the config: `FANOUT_SHARDS` is unset (defaults to 1, yikes) and `ALERT_TOPIC_PREFIX` points at the retired `wx-old` topics. Please review my fix — I set shards to 8 and updated the prefix. The publisher also couldn't auth against the Brillow message broker, so I added this line to the worker env file:

sealed setting: ARCHIVE_KEY3=8d0